What is Willcox International Holdings Equity-to-Asset?

Willcox International Holdings WINH Equity-to-Asset is 0.98 as of Sep. 2017.

Equity to Asset ratio is calculated as total stockholders equity divided by total asset. Willcox International Holdings's Total Stockholders Equity for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2017 was $15.52 Mil. Willcox International Holdings's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2017 was $15.79 Mil.

Willcox International Holdings  (OTCPK:WINH) Equity-to-Asset Explanation

Equity to Asset ratio can vary greatly across different industries, as they have different capital structure. A company with smaller Equity to Asset ratio (more leveraged) may have higher ROE % because of the leverage.

For banks, the required minimum Equity to Asset ratio by regulation is 5%. Some stronger banks may have Equity to Asset Ratio of more than 10%.

Willcox International Holdings Equity-to-Asset Calculation

Equity to Asset ratio measures the ratios of the portion of the asset owned by shareholders out of the total asset. It indicates the leverage of the company, and the amount of debt the company uses in its operation.

Equity to Asset ratio is calculated by dividing total stockholders equity by total asset.

Willcox International Holdings's Equity to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2017 is calculated as

Equity to Asset (A: Mar. 2017 )=Total Stockholders Equity/Total Assets
=12.837/13.042
=0.98

Willcox International Holdings Business Description

Address 13935 Lynmar Boulevard, Tampa, FL, USA, 33626
Willcox International Holdings Inc is a U.S based company focused on opportunities in the lithium production and renewable energy fields, its projects include lithium extraction, new battery and storage technology and recycling.
